> Reviving a year old commit...
>
> The LUKS driver doesn't implement preallocation during create.
>
> Before this commit this would be reported
>
> $ qemu-img create -f luks --object secret,id=sec0,data=base -o
> key-secret=sec0 base.luks 1G -o preallocation=full
> Formatting 'base.luks', fmt=luks size=1073741824 key-secret=sec0
> preallocation=full
> qemu-img: base.luks: Parameter 'preallocation' is unexpected
>
> After this commit, there is no error reported - it just silently
> ignores the preallocation=full option.
>
> I'm a bit lost in block layer understanding where is the right
> place to fix the error reporting in this case.
Hmm, this looked strange at first, but I see now where the difference
is.
In the old state, crypto used qemu_opts_to_qdict() and then fed all
options to its own visitor. I'm not sure whether I can clearly call this
a bug, but it's different from other format drivers, which parse all
options they know and pass the rest to the protocol driver.
The new version was converted to use qemu_opts_to_qdict_filtered() like
in all other drivers, so we got the same behaviour in crypto: Unknown
options are passed to the protocol.
As it happens, file-posix does support 'preallocation', so the operation
will return success now. Of course, passing the preallocation to the
protocol level is questionable for non-raw image formats, and completely
useless when you create the protocol level with size 0 and you'll call
blk_truncate() later.
I think we would get back to the old state if you just changed the
qemu_opts_to_qdict_filtered() call back to qemu_opts_to_qdict(). But it
make the driver inconsistent with other drivers again.
Maybe the best way to solve this would be to just implement
preallocation. It should be as easy as adding a 'preallocation' create
option (in QAPI and block_crypto_create_opts_luks), putting the
PreallocMode into BlockCryptoCreateData and then passing it to the
blk_truncate() call in block_crypto_init_func().
